commit:     51f180d4adf8208cd49e0ed6c6aaf9559c14b677
Author:     Eli Schwartz <eschwartz <AT> gentoo <DOT> org>
AuthorDate: Sun May  4 22:32:09 2025 +0000
Commit:     Eli Schwartz <eschwartz <AT> gentoo <DOT> org>
CommitDate: Sun May  4 22:37:11 2025 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=51f180d4

dev-python/html2text: fix file conflicts due to unapplied sed

```
 * SED: the following did not cause any changes
 *     sed -e 's/html2text = html2text.cli:main/py\0/' -i setup.cfg || die;
 * no-op: -e s/html2text = html2text.cli:main/py\0/
```

And on merge:

```
 * Detected file collision(s):
 *
 *      /usr/bin/html2text
 *
 * Searching all installed packages for file collisions...
 *
 * Press Ctrl-C to Stop
 *
 * app-text/html2text-2.2.3:0::gentoo
 *      /usr/bin/html2text
 *
 * Package 'dev-python/html2text-2025.4.15' NOT merged due to file
 * collisions. If necessary, refer to your elog messages for the whole
 * content of the above message.
```

Regression in commit 989f1d35a84d9755eced0c36e4bdd99ef992e6b9 which
bumped to a version that ported the upstream build system to use
pyproject.toml. Same information, different file.

Fixes: 989f1d35a84d9755eced0c36e4bdd99ef992e6b9
Signed-off-by: Eli Schwartz <eschwartz <AT> gentoo.org>

 .../{html2text-2025.4.15.ebuild => html2text-2025.4.15-r1.ebuild}       |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/dev-python/html2text/html2text-2025.4.15.ebuild 
b/dev-python/html2text/html2text-2025.4.15-r1.ebuild
similarity index 90%
rename from dev-python/html2text/html2text-2025.4.15.ebuild
rename to dev-python/html2text/html2text-2025.4.15-r1.ebuild
index 9ff465278ffa..de8f32e83486 100644
--- a/dev-python/html2text/html2text-2025.4.15.ebuild
+++ b/dev-python/html2text/html2text-2025.4.15-r1.ebuild
@@ -28,6 +28,6 @@ distutils_enable_tests pytest
 
 src_prepare() {
        # naming conflict with app-text/html2text, bug 421647
-       sed -e 's/html2text = html2text.cli:main/py\0/' -i setup.cfg || die
+       sed -e 's/html2text = "html2text.cli:main"/py\0/' -i pyproject.toml || 
die
        distutils-r1_src_prepare
 }

Reply via email to